>>>> On 31.08.2015, at 23:47, Vinod Kone <vinodk...@apache.org> wrote:
>>>>
>>>> I think you might be confused with the HTTP chunked encoding and
>>>> RecordIO encoding. Most HTTP client libraries dechunk the stream before
>>>> presenting it to the application. So the application needs to know the
>>>> encoding of the dechunked data to be able to process it.
>>>>
>>>> In Mesos's case, the server (master here) can encode it in JSON or
>>>> Protobuf. We wanted to have a consistent way to encode both these formats
>>>> and Record-IO format was the one we settled on. Note that this format is
>>>> also used by the Twitter streaming API
>>>> <https://dev.twitter.com/streaming/overview/processing> (see delimited
>>>> messages section).

>>>>>> On Fri, Aug 28, 2015 at 7:53 AM, Anand Mazumdar <an...@mesosphere.io>
>>>>>> wrote:
>>>>>>
>>>>>>> Dario,
>>>>>>>
>>>>>>> Thanks for the detailed explanation and for trying out the new API.
>>>>>>> However, this is not a bug. The output from CURL is the encoding used by
>>>>>>> Mesos for the events stream. From the user doc
>>>>>>> <https://github.com/apache/mesos/blob/master/docs/scheduler_http_api.md>
>>>>>>> :
>>>>>>>
>>>>>>> *"Master encodes each Event in RecordIO format, i.e., string
>>>>>>> representation of length of the event in bytes followed by JSON or 
>>>>>>> binary
>>>>>>> Protobuf  (possibly compressed) encoded event. Note that the value of
>>>>>>> length will never be ‘0’ and the size of the length will be the size of
>>>>>>> unsigned integer (i.e., 64 bits). Also, note that the RecordIO encoding
>>>>>>> should be decoded by the scheduler whereas the underlying HTTP chunked
>>>>>>> encoding is typically invisible at the application (scheduler) layer.“*
>>>>>>>
>>>>>>> If you run CURL with tracing enabled i.e. —trace, the output would
>>>>>>> be something similar to this:
>>>>>>>
>>>>>>> <= Recv header, 2 bytes (0x2)
>>>>>>> 0000: 0d 0a                                           ..
>>>>>>> <= Recv data, 115 bytes (0x73)
>>>>>>> 0000: 36 64 0d 0a 31 30 35 0a 7b 22 73 75 62 73 63 72
>>>>>>> 6d..105.{"subscr
>>>>>>> 0010: 69 62 65 64 22 3a 7b 22 66 72 61 6d 65 77 6f 72
>>>>>>> ibed":{"framewor
>>>>>>> 0020: 6b 5f 69 64 22 3a 7b 22 76 61 6c 75 65 22 3a 22
>>>>>>> k_id":{"value":"
>>>>>>> 0030: 32 30 31 35 30 38 32 35 2d 31 30 33 30 31 38 2d
>>>>>>> 20150825-103018-
>>>>>>> 0040: 33 38 36 33 38 37 31 34 39 38 2d 35 30 35 30 2d
>>>>>>> 3863871498-5050-
>>>>>>> 0050: 31 31 38 35 2d 30 30 31 30 22 7d 7d 2c 22 74 79
>>>>>>> 1185-0010"}},"ty
>>>>>>> 0060: 70 65 22 3a 22 53 55 42 53 43 52 49 42 45 44 22
>>>>>>> pe":"SUBSCRIBED"
>>>>>>> 0070: 7d 0d 0a                                        }..
>>>>>>> <others
>>>>>>>
>>>>>>> In the output above, the chunks are correctly delimited by ‘CRLF'
>>>>>>> (0d 0a) as per the HTTP RFC. As mentioned earlier, the output that you
>>>>>>> observe on stdout with CURL is of the Record-IO encoding used for the
>>>>>>> events stream ( and is not related to the RFC ):
>>>>>>>
>>>>>>> event = event-size LF
>>>>>>>              event-data
>>>>>>>

>>>>>>> On Aug 28, 2015, at 12:56 AM, Dario Rexin <dario.re...@me.com>
>>>>>>> wrote:
>>>>>>>
>>>>>>> -1 (non-binding)
>>>>>>>
>>>>>>> I found a breaking bug in the new HTTP API. The messages do not
>>>>>>> conform to the HTTP standard for chunked transfer encoding. in RFC 2616
>>>>>>> Sec. 3 (http://www.w3.org/Protocols/rfc2616/rfc2616-sec3.html) a
>>>>>>> chunk is defined as:
>>>>>>>
>>>>>>> chunk = chunk-size [ chunk-extension ] CRLF
>>>>>>>         chunk-data CRLF
>>>>>>>
>>>>>>>
>>>>>>> The HTTP API currently sends a chunk as:
>>>>>>>
>>>>>>> chunk = chunk-size LF
>>>>>>>         chunk-data
>>>>>>>
>>>>>>>
>>>>>>> A standard conform HTTP client like curl can’t correctly interpret
>>>>>>> the data as a complete chunk. In curl it currently looks like this:
>>>>>>>
>>>>>>> 104
>>>>>>>
>>>>>>> {"subscribed":{"framework_id":{"value":"20150820-114552-16777343-5050-43704-0000"}},"type":"SUBSCRIBED"}20
>>>>>>> {"type":"HEARTBEAT”}666
>>>>>>> …. waiting …
>>>>>>>
>>>>>>> {"offers":{"offers":[{"agent_id":{"value":"20150820-114552-16777343-5050-43704-S0"},"framework_id":{"value":"20150820-114552-16777343-5050-43704-0000"},"hostname":"localhost","id":{"value":"20150820-114552-16777343-5050-43704-O0"},"resources":[{"name":"cpus","role":"*","scalar":{"value":8},"type":"SCALAR"},{"name":"mem","role":"*","scalar":{"value":15360},"type":"SCALAR"},{"name":"disk","role":"*","scalar":{"value":2965448},"type":"SCALAR"},{"name":"ports","ranges":{"range":[{"begin":31000,"end":32000}]},"role":"*","type":"RANGES"}],"url":{"address":{"hostname":"localhost","ip":"127.0.0.1","port":5051},"path":"\/slave(1)","scheme":"http"}}]},"type":"OFFERS”}20
>>>>>>> … waiting …
>>>>>>> {"type":"HEARTBEAT”}20
>>>>>>> … waiting …
>>>>>>>
>>>>>>> It will receive a couple of messages after successful registration
>>>>>>> with the master and the last thing printed is a number (in this case 
>>>>>>> 666).
>>>>>>> Then after some time it will print the first offers message followed by 
>>>>>>> the
>>>>>>> number 20. The explanation for this behavior is, that curl can’t 
>>>>>>> interpret
>>>>>>> the data it gets from Mesos as a complete chunk and waits for the 
>>>>>>> missing
>>>>>>> data. So it prints what it thinks is a chunk (a message followed by the
>>>>>>> size of the next messsage) and keeps the rest of the message until 
>>>>>>> another
>>>>>>> message arrives and so on. The fix for this is to terminate both lines, 
>>>>>>> the
>>>>>>> message size and the message data, with CRLF.
